Server-free cloud service system, resource management method thereof and electronic equipment
A resource management and serverless technology, which is applied in the field of cloud services, can solve the problems of complex expansion and high cost investment, and achieve the effects of convenient operation, low initial cost investment, and easy expansion
- Summary
- Abstract
- Description
- Claims
- Application Information
AI Technical Summary
Problems solved by technology
Method used
Image
Examples
Embodiment 1
[0032] The method provided by the embodiment of the present invention can be applied to any business system with serverless cloud service function. Figure 1a A system block diagram of an embodiment of the serverless cloud service system provided by the present invention. Such as Figure 1a As shown, a virtual node for managing virtual machines is set in the cluster of the system, and a container group control module (Pod control module) and a container control module are set in the virtual machine (VM); wherein, the virtual node is used to obtain user requirements resource change event, form a resource management command according to the resource change event, communicate with the container group control module, and issue a resource management command; the container group control module is used to communicate with the virtual node, receive the resource management command, and according to the resource management command The Pod performs event management; the container control ...
Embodiment 2
[0038] figure 2 It is a schematic structural diagram of a virtual node in an embodiment of the serverless cloud service system provided by the present invention. The serverless cloud service system may be based on the Serverless Kubernetes service. Such as figure 2 shown in the above Figure 1a On the basis of the illustrated embodiment, the virtual node (Viking) 21 can obtain resource change events in user requirements through a listening server (Kube-apiserver). The resource change event in the user requirement can be a container group (Pod) event, a service (Service) event or an entry (Ingress) event.
[0039] When the resource change event is a Pod event, the virtual node (Viking) 21 may include: a first management module 211 . The first management module 211 can be used to create or destroy a virtual machine instance according to the Pod event.
[0040] Specifically, the first management module 211 may call a VM application programming interface (Application Program...
Embodiment 3
[0049] image 3 It is a flow chart of an embodiment of the resource management method of the serverless cloud service system provided by the present invention, and the execution subject of the method may be the above-mentioned serverless cloud service system. Such as image 3 As shown, virtual nodes for managing virtual machines are set in the cluster of the system, and a container group control module (Pod control module) and a container control module (Containerd) are set in the virtual machine (VM). The resource management method of the serverless cloud service system may include the following steps:
[0050] S301. The virtual node acquires a resource change event in user demand, forms a resource management instruction according to the resource change event, communicates with the container group control module, and issues the resource management instruction.
[0051] In the embodiment of the present invention, the serverless cloud service system architecture can be based ...
PUM
Abstract
Description
Claims
Application Information
- R&D Engineer
- R&D Manager
- IP Professional
- Industry Leading Data Capabilities
- Powerful AI technology
- Patent DNA Extraction
Browse by: Latest US Patents, China's latest patents, Technical Efficacy Thesaurus, Application Domain, Technology Topic, Popular Technical Reports.
© 2024 PatSnap. All rights reserved.Legal|Privacy policy|Modern Slavery Act Transparency Statement|Sitemap|About US| Contact US: help@patsnap.com